卖逼视频免费看片|狼人就干网中文字慕|成人av影院导航|人妻少妇精品无码专区二区妖婧|亚洲丝袜视频玖玖|一区二区免费中文|日本高清无码一区|国产91无码小说|国产黄片子视频91sese日韩|免费高清无码成人网站入口

eclipse怎么還原git上拉取的代碼

在開發(fā)過程中,我們經(jīng)常使用git來管理項目的版本控制。有時候,我們可能會不小心拉取了錯誤的代碼,導(dǎo)致項目出現(xiàn)問題。這時候,我們就需要恢復(fù)之前正確的代碼。 一種常見的情況是,我們在本地修改了文件,然后

在開發(fā)過程中,我們經(jīng)常使用git來管理項目的版本控制。有時候,我們可能會不小心拉取了錯誤的代碼,導(dǎo)致項目出現(xiàn)問題。這時候,我們就需要恢復(fù)之前正確的代碼。

一種常見的情況是,我們在本地修改了文件,然后通過git拉取了最新的代碼,導(dǎo)致我們本地的修改被覆蓋了。下面我們將介紹兩種方法來恢復(fù)被git拉取的代碼。

方法一: 使用git命令

1. 首先,通過以下命令查看git的提交歷史:

git log

2. 找到你想恢復(fù)的版本號(commit id),復(fù)制該版本號。

3. 然后使用以下命令回滾到指定版本:

git reset --hard commit_id

這樣就可以將項目回滾到指定的版本,恢復(fù)被git拉取的代碼。

方法二: 使用Eclipse插件

1. 在Eclipse中,找到Git視圖。如果沒有打開,請選擇“窗口”->“顯示視圖”->“其他”,然后在彈出的窗口中選擇“Git”。

2. 在Git視圖中,找到項目的分支,右鍵點擊并選擇“Team”->“Show in History”。

3. 在歷史記錄中找到你想恢復(fù)的版本,右鍵點擊并選擇“Reset”,選擇“Hard”選項。

這樣就可以通過Eclipse插件回滾到指定版本,恢復(fù)被git拉取的代碼。

注意事項

1. 請在操作前備份你的代碼,以防不可預(yù)料的錯誤導(dǎo)致代碼丟失。

2. 如果你已經(jīng)推送了錯誤的代碼到遠程倉庫,那么回滾操作只會影響本地代碼,遠程倉庫的代碼不會改變。

3. 在使用git命令回滾時,如果回滾后有新的提交,之前的提交將無法恢復(fù)。

以上是在Eclipse中恢復(fù)被git拉取的代碼的詳細步驟和注意事項。希望對你有所幫助!